Output 3ee9217857291bb64ef82771211eb2804fabefafbee9986ff372a680381f94c9:21

value
114824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 723d66106a6959b7428b7360cacfafa50c18a62f OP_EQUAL
address
3C74WU6nAKM6EHnaEuNMzahcDqFeMACWdW
transaction
3ee9217857291bb64ef82771211eb2804fabefafbee9986ff372a680381f94c9
confirmations
205281
spent
true